> (1) At zero pressure, for a non-cubic (tetragonal) case,  I put --
> what='mur_lc_t'  and still obtain    this error :
> 
> task #         7
>      from thermo_summary : error #         1
>      Thermal expansion not available

Either you are using an old version, or ibrav=0. Thermo_pw poorly
supports the option ibrav=0. You should use ibrav=6 or 7 for tetragonal.
